DEPARTMENT DESCRIPTION 

On behalf of BCI’s clients, the Infrastructure & Renewable Resources (I&RR) team invests globally in infrastructure assets and businesses that provide stable long-term investment returns. BCI’s I&RR portfolio has $28+ billion in AUM and ranks as the ninth largest institutional infrastructure investor globally. The portfolio spans a range of sectors including energy, transport, utilities, and data infrastructure as well as tangible assets such as timberland and agriculture.   

I&RR seeks meaningful investments predominantly in private companies that allow us to pursue an active governance approach. The team invests in a variety of capacities in private markets including as a sole sponsor, co-sponsor, and very selectively through externally managed funds. In addition, I&RR takes positions in listed infrastructure businesses as well as debt investments as a complementary strategy to private markets investments.   

In 2023, the I&RR team established their first international presence with the inauguration of its London, UK office. The new London office serves as a strong platform for the team to originate and manage investments in the UK and European markets. Since opening, the London team has completed five infrastructure debt and equity deals, and has a growing pipeline of transactions to further solidify BCI's commitment to global expansion and diversification.
